This is a full time in office role for a Real Estate Clerk located in Kingston, ON. The Real Estate Clerk will be responsible for preparing legal documents, conducting legal research, drafting correspondence, and providing administrative support for real estate transactions. Additional tasks will include effective communication with clients, maintaining files, and ensuring compliance with legal procedures and policies.
Responsibilities
Manage all aspects of real estate transactions from initial client intake to closing.
Prepare and review legal documents, including purchase agreements, mortgages, transfers, and title searches.
Communicate effectively with clients, lenders, real estate agents, and other parties involved in the transaction.
Prepare closing documents and ensure accurate and timely completion of transactions.
Maintain organized and accurate files.
Stay up-to-date on current real estate law and regulations.
Qualifications
Knowledge and experience in Real Estate law and legal document preparation
Experience with Teraview, Unity and PC Law software
Proficient in research and writing
Solid communication skills
Attention to detail and organization skills
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a team environment
Experience in real estate law is required
Law clerk diploma
Salary Range: $45,000.00 - $55,000.00
